While details may evolve, our goal is to create an environment where innovation thrives, with office-based teams coming together three days a week to collaborate and thrive, together!Your Career Palo Alto Networks® SaaS Security team is looking for a seasoned and accomplished Senior Staff Software Engineer to help scale out our security platform with a sharp focus on platform and infrastructure capabilities. As a member of the team, you have the unique opportunity to:

Be part of a world-class software engineering team that works on various ground-breaking cloud security service offerings

Lead initiatives in the platform team to deliver security as a service in the public cloud by providing highly scalable, highly available, and fault-tolerant solutions

Be expected to lead and participate in all phases of the product development cycle, from definition, design, through implementation, test, and field deployment

Your Impact

Drives the architecture and development for key modules via architecture/design documents and developing key code modules

Develops architectures that are inherently secure, robust, scalable, modular, API-centric and global

Applies architecture best practices that helps increase execution velocity- Align solutions with the SaaS Security vision

Lead and/or Influence technology selection for SaaS Security solutions

Partner with Product Managers to define/refine roadmap, discuss trade-offs of key features and architectures, help them balance features, innovation and tech debt prioritization - Be a “sounding board” for PM ideas, propose new features and innovation ideas

Partner with Devops teams and other peers across the team to develop best-of-breed deployment architectures

Your Experience

5+ years of work experience preferably with a Masters degree (in computer science) or a minimum of 5+ years of work experience or equivalent military experience required

Prior experience as an architect supporting a cloud security product engineering team

Proven track record of successful architecture and design for high transactions and data volume in enterprise and/or consumer facing applications

5+ years of experience in Cloud technologies - GCP plus at least one other cloud provider (Azure, AWS or OCI)

5+ years of experience with large scale cloud applications experience built with one or more these languages - Java, Scala, GoLang, Python

Expert in database technologies (e.g., MemSQL, SQL, Cassandra, etc.), queuing systems (e.g., Kafka, Pulsar, Akka streams, etc.) - The ideal candidate will have 5+ years of experience in these technologies

3+ years experience in Apache Spark, data analytics frameworks

Good understanding of security, cloud security domain a plus - Experience with an enterprise security product (on-prem or cloud)
